Eat in San Francisco: Honey Creme


Honey soft-serve ice cream

This past weekend I stopped by Honey Creme while taking a lunch break from the San Francisco Zine Festival. Located on Irving between 9th and 10th Avenues in the Inner Sunset, Honey Creme serves soft-serve ice cream with a variety of decadent toppings.

I ordered the Honey flavor: their original soft-serve ice cream drizzled with honey. It was just what I needed on a warm day in the city. The soft-serve had a nice flavor for a base -- not too sweet. The honey added a touch of sweetness I really enjoyed.

The next time I stop by Honey Creme I want to try the Honey Comb, Affogato, Churros, or the Bacon Chocolate ice cream. (So basically most of the menu...)
